Plum Creek town hall meeting points to progressing plans, ongoing discontent
Cars jammed the Chester Shell Elementary School parking lot and spilled along side streets and into an empty field. Inside the cafeteria, it was standing room only, and latecomers leaned against the walls. City to Discuss Power District Development, QTI Incentive for BioMonde
By Caitlyn Finnegan Gainesville city commissioners face two important economic development decisions Thursday during two separate meetings at City Hall. The first will be a discussion of the Power District Catalyst Project Lease Amendment, a motion involving engineering firm Prioria Robotics. City Commission Hosts Public Forum to Discuss Vision for Future Development
By Caitlyn Finnegan The Gainesville City Commission is preparing to tackle the 2013-2014 fiscal year budget – but first it wants input from the community. Commissioners let residents voice their opinions for future spending plans during the fifth annual “Focus on the Future” city forum Tuesday evening at the Gainesville/Alachua County Senior Recreation Center.
